ADDITIONAL INFORMATION TO EMPLOYERS AND OTHER WITHHOLDERS
If checked, you are required to provide a copy of this form to your employee. If your employee works in a state that is different from the state that issued this order, a copy must be provided to your employee even if the box is not checked.

Priority: Withholding under this OrderNotice has priority over any other legal process under State law against the same income. Federal tax levies in effect before receipt of this Order have priority. If there are Federal tax levies in effect, please contact the requesting agency listed below. Combining Payments: You can combine withheld amounts from more than one employee/obligor's income in a single payment to each agency requesting withholding. You must, however, separately identi@ the portion of the single payment that is attributable to each employeelobligor. Reporting the Paydatemate of Withholding: You must report the paydateldate of withholding when sending the payment. The paydateldate of withholding is the date on which the amount was withheld from the employee's wages. Liability: Ifyou fail to withhold income as the OrderINotice directs, you are liable for both the accumulated amount you should have withheld from the employee'slobligor's income and any other penalties set by State law. You may be found liable for the total amount which you fail to withhold or pay over and fines as provided by state law. Anti-discrimination: You are subject to a fine determined under the State law for discharging an employeelobligor from employment, refusing to employ, or taking disciplinary action against any employeelobligor because of child support withholding. Withholding Limits: You may not withhold more than the lesser oE I) the amounts allowed by the Federal Consumer Credit Protection Act (15 U.S.C. $1673(b)); or 2) the amounts allowed by the State of the employeelobligor's principal place of employment. The Federal limit applies to the aggregate disposable weekly earnings (ADWE). ADWE is the net income left after making mandatory deductions, such as: State, Federal, local taxes; Social Security taxes, and Medicare taxes and statutory pension contnbutions. The Federal CCPA limit is 50% of the ADWE for child support and alimony, which is increased by 1) 10% if the employee does not support a second family; andlor 2) 5% if arrears are more than 12 weeks old.
